dede如何按自己寫的ID進行排序

2022-08-31 06:09:10 字數 849 閱讀 8079

點評:dede排序問題:如何按自己寫的id排序,更改一下函式。即可輕鬆實現,下面有個具體的示例,大家可以參考下。

更改一下函式,實現排序方式根據自己寫的id排序就好了。 方法: 1、開啟include/taglib/channelartlist.lib.php,找到大約78行,把

$dsql->setquery("

select id,typename,typedir,isdefault,ispart,defaultname,namerule2,moresite,siteurl,sitepath from `dede_arctype` where $tpsql order by sortrank asc limit $totalnum

");

修改為:

$dsql->setquery("

select id,typename,typedir,isdefault,ispart,defaultname,namerule2,moresite,siteurl,sitepath from `dede_arctype` where $tpsql order by substring_index('$typeid',id,1) limit $totalnum

");

2、前台呼叫標籤:

<

li><

a href

='[field:typeurl/]'

[field:rel/]

>[field:typename/]

a>

li>

根據欄目的id排序,想要什麼樣的排序更改id的先後順序就好了,

如何寫自己的lib檔案並測試

1 在vs 中新建乙個 win32 工程,建立時選擇靜態庫,如圖 2 也可新建乙個win32 專案,然後在工程 配置屬性 常規中選擇,如圖 3 新建乙個getimagename.h 檔案和乙個 getimagename.cpp檔案 getimagename.h檔案 ifndef get image ...

Python2 7 如何引入自己寫的類

系統環境 win10 開發環境 jetbrains pycharm 2017.1.5 x64 python版本 2.7 假如我們有乙個class叫dbutil,它在a.py裡 最好乙個py檔案中對應乙個class,這樣比較清晰 它應該具有init self 函式。就像這樣 class dbutil ...

如何在新版的gitbook上寫自己的書

之前為了學習qt當中的qmake,就去看qt的官方文件,但qt的官方文件都是英文的,而自己本身英文較差,就一咬牙決定不如就把qmake的使用文件翻譯一下吧。這樣即可以加深對文件的理解,也可以留著自己以後查閱,順便也可以將自己的文件放在網上給想要的人進行查閱。於是就開始查詢相關的工具,幾經輾轉找到了g...